Output 03898d3589da44af268c6fe3d80af8b4f440bd1b1bce39708d82158ad0e75f9f:4

value
292209809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 591d66bb26ca2f20dd7b6ce1736a72213b54e256 OP_EQUAL
address
39pDHTJcCMDrWa9ZFyhApVYCQTbTwQtJVY
transaction
03898d3589da44af268c6fe3d80af8b4f440bd1b1bce39708d82158ad0e75f9f
spent
true